While Canada is voting for its future leader, we’ll hear from a noteworthy leader from our past at the same time.

Jean Chrétien was Canada’s 20th prime minister and held the position for 10 years. He was known for his support of official bilingualism, multiculturalism, and his support of global issues.

In our closing general session on Tuesday, Rabia Siddique takes the stage to engage your heart and mind with her powerful story. She will speak of many times in her life when she was outside of her comfort zone.

Rabia is an Australian criminal and human rights lawyer, retired British Army officer and hostage survivor. When the UK Ministry of Defence didn’t recognize her role in rescuing captured Special Forces soldiers in Iraq, she sued them for discrimination and won.

While telling her story, Rabia challenges audiences to consider their perceptions, expectation and behavior and consider what can they change.

This year marks the 10th anniversary of the ‘Miracle on the Hudson,’ and Captain Sully will share with us his inspirational stories of leadership, preparation and courage.

On January 15, 2009, Sullenberger captained US Airways Flight 1549 which struck a large flock of birds, losing power in both engines. Sullenberger was regarded as a hero after leading his crew during the successful emergency landing on the Hudson River in New York City in which everyone survived.

Since then, Sullenberger has helped develop new protocols for airline safety, has become an advocate for the safety of air travelers, and his best-selling memoir was adapted into a successful feature film starring Tom Hanks.
